Question: Which Himalayan Range Has All The Highest Peaks?

The range has many of the Earth’s highest peaks, including the highest, Mount Everest.

The Himalayas include over fifty mountains exceeding 7,200 m (23,600 ft) in elevation, including ten of the fourteen 8,000-metre peaks.

By contrast, the highest peak outside Asia (Aconcagua, in the Andes) is 6,961 m (22,838 ft) tall.

Are Kanchenjunga and k2 same?

No , K2 & Kanchenjunga are 2 Different Mountains. K2 is the second highest mountain in the world, after Mount Everest, at 8,611 metres (28,251 ft) above sea level. K2 is the highest point of the Karakoram range and the highest point in both Pakistan and Xinjiang.

Where are the longest continuous mountain ranges on Earth?

The longest mountain range on Earth is called the mid-ocean ridge. Spanning 40,389 miles around the globe, it’s truly a global landmark. About 90 percent of the mid-ocean ridge system is under the ocean.

Is k2 more dangerous than Everest?

Although Everest is 237m taller, K2 is widely perceived to be a far harder climb. “It’s a very serious and very dangerous mountain,” adds Sir Chris. “No matter which route you take it’s a technically difficult climb, much harder than Everest.

Who has climbed all 14 8000m peaks?

The first winter ascent of an eight-thousander was done by a Polish team led by Andrzej Zawada on Mount Everest. Two climbers Leszek Cichy and Krzysztof Wielicki reached the summit on 17 February 1980. The first person to climb all 14 eight-thousanders was the Italian Reinhold Messner, on 16 October 1986.

Why is k2 called Godwin?

K2. Montgomerie of the Survey of India, and it was given the symbol K2 because it was the second peak measured in the Karakoram Range. The name Mount Godwin Austen is for the peak’s first surveyor, Col. H.H. Godwin Austen, a 19th-century English geographer.

Has every mountain in the world been climbed?

The mountain most widely claimed to be the highest unclimbed mountain in the world in terms of elevation is Gangkhar Puensum (7,570 m (24,840 ft)). In Bhutan, the climbing of mountains higher than 6,000 m (20,000 ft) has been prohibited since 1994.

Is Kilimanjaro the second highest mountain in the world?

Mount Kilimanjaro is the tallest mountain on the African continent and the highest free-standing mountain in the world. Kilimanjaro has three volcanic cones, Mawenzi, Shira and Kibo. Mawenzi and Shira are extinct but Kibo, the highest peak, is dormant and could erupt again.
